Delta Dental is Hiring a Sr. HR Business Partner Near Centennial, CO

The Sr. Human Resources Business Partner is a hybrid position requiring three days a week in our Centennial, Colorado office.

Salary range: $99,466 - $117,624 per year

Closing date: Friday, May 31st, 2024

Qualifications: 

Education and Experience: 

  • PHR, SPHR, or other HR certifications. 
  • Bachelor's in human resource management or equivalent education and/or experience. 
  • Five plus years of HR industry experience with strong knowledge in a broad range of HR functional areas especially employee relations. 
  • Strong knowledge of HR principles, practices, and regulations, with a proven track record of implementing effective HR strategies and programs. 
  • Proven track record of proactively identifying areas for improvement, taking the lead on projects, and driving them to completion. 

Skills and Abilities: 

  • Knowledge and demonstrated experience as a consultant and advisor to management in key human resources areas, including employee relations, employment law, performance coaching, and management. 
  • Solid background in HR practices and strong knowledge of relevant employment laws and regulations. 
  • Proven ability to effectively handle complex employee relations matters. Trained in internal investigations. 
  • Demonstrated interpersonal skills and understanding of group dynamics. Successful track record of establishing credibility and trust with a diverse client group. 
  • Strong analytical, critical thinking, problem-solving, judgment, negotiating, influencing, and decision-making skills. Ability to maintain confidentiality, tact, and diplomacy. 
  • Strong collaborative skills to work with cross-functional teams and HR colleagues. 
  • Demonstrated proficiency with business applications, such as Microsoft Office suite and human resource information systems, UKG preferred. 
  • Demonstrated ability to plan and accomplish multiple priorities simultaneously while maintaining a high degree of organizational responsiveness. 
  • Experience with change management is a plus. 

Essential Functions: 

  • Establish strong partnerships with the business to understand its strategic objectives, challenges, and talent needs. Proactively provide guidance and support on HR matters to drive the achievement of business goals. 
  • Proactively identifies business issues and opportunities throughout the organization. Challenges assumptions to help define opportunities recommends solutions based on business knowledge and HR expertise. Communicates and influences the case for initiating a business change to key stakeholders, overcomes resistance, and measures impact. 
  • Partner with leaders to attract, motivate, develop, and retain the best talent in support of the business. Influence positive performance outcomes for the team members and the business through HR expertise, data, and strong relationships.
  • Guide managers on performance management processes, including goal setting, performance reviews, feedback, and development plans. Help establish a culture of partnering for performance to drive team member growth and development. 
  • Provide guidance and support on team member relations matters, including conflict resolution, disciplinary actions, and investigations. Ensure compliance with local labor laws and regulations. Effectively conduct formal reviews as warranted and recommend any action steps based on data gathered. 
  • Recommend organizational development strategies to leaders, including quality improvement, performance enhancement approaches, and problem-solving by analyzing departmental trends and performance outcomes. Conducts assessments, gap analysis, and strategy development for individual learning and organizational development. 
  • Lead initiatives to support our company’s organizational culture, promoting inclusivity, collaboration, and team member engagement through the implementation of targeted programs and activities. 
  • Contribute to department budget, goals, objectives, and technology solutions. Recommend new approaches, guidelines, and procedures to automate and benchmark data to continually improve the efficiency and effectiveness of the human resources function and organization. 
  • Drive assigned HR projects/programs for implementation and impact across the organization. 
  • Work as the ambassador of the HR department to represent the services and resources available to team members and help lead the collective reputation of the HR team. 
  • Integrate Diversity, Equity, Inclusion and belonging initiatives into everyday HR activities ensuring equitable approaches to provide growth opportunities for team members. 

Other Responsibilities: 

  • Serve as backup to peers and/or the Director of HR as needed. 
  • Perform special projects and additional duties and responsibilities as requested. 

Working Conditions: 

  • This job operates in a professional office environment. This role routinely uses standard office equipment such as computers, phones, and photocopiers. 
  • Ability to perform the essential functions of the job with or without reasonable accommodation. 
  • No physical effort beyond that is typically required in a normal office environment. 
  • Regular exposure to a computer screen.
  • This position is a hybrid role that requires at least three days per week in the office based on the organization's needs.
  • Some evenings and weekends may be required.
